Description
Two Towns Down is a brewing project founded by Sandy McKelvie.
Sandy started his brewing career in the Isle of Man before returning to his native Scotland to complete the Brewing and Distilling Degree at Heriot Watt University. In his third year he was also the in-house brewer at the Hanging Bat which included collabs with the likes of Six Degrees North.
Once the four year course was complete he took a brewing position at Fallen Brewing Co. before moving on to head up recipe development and barrel aging at Black Isle Brewing Co. Having recently relocated to 71 Brewing in Dundee, Sandy has taken the opportunity to launch his own project, showcasing innovative and cutting edge beers while still drawing inspiration from classic brewing philosophies.
